[Asia Economy Reporter Ki-min Lee] BMW Korea announced on the 22nd that it will launch four limited online edition models for February on the 23rd of this month.


The models include ▲New M5 Competition Imola Red ▲M2 CS Carbon Ceramic ▲New M550i xDrive British Racing Green ▲M340i Dravit Grey, all of which will be sold through BMW's online sales channel, BMW Shop Online.


The New M5 Competition Imola Red, limited to only 5 units, features BMW's signature Imola Red exterior color with M-exclusive parts in Jet Black.


The interior is equipped with BMW's anthracite headliner and galvanic interior, premium Merino leather seats, M-exclusive multifunction steering wheel, instrument panel, gear lever, and M seat belts.


The New M5 Competition Imola Red is powered by a 4.4-liter V8 M TwinPower Turbo engine delivering a maximum output of 625 horsepower and maximum torque of 76.5 kg·m, paired with an 8-speed M Steptronic automatic transmission, achieving a 0-100 km/h acceleration time of just 3.3 seconds. The price is 167.6 million KRW including VAT.

The M2 CS Carbon Ceramic is a limited edition of 4 units based on the ultra-high-performance compact coupe M2 CS, focused on track driving, featuring the Hockenheim Silver Metallic color.


Under the hood, it is equipped with an M TwinPower Turbo inline 6-cylinder gasoline engine producing 450 horsepower and 56.1 kg·m of torque. It is paired with a 7-speed M double-clutch transmission, achieving a 0-100 km/h acceleration time of 4 seconds and a top speed of 280 km/h.


The exterior features a carbon fiber hood, roof, front splitter, side mirrors, rear spoiler, and diffuser. The interior includes lightweight M sport seats combining Alcantara and Merino leather, an M Alcantara steering wheel, and CS-exclusive interior trims. The price of the M2 CS Carbon Ceramic is 122.5 million KRW including VAT.

The New M550i xDrive British Racing Green is limited to 25 units. The exterior features BMW's signature British Racing Green color symbolizing racing heritage, combined with M-exclusive Cerium Grey side mirrors and 20-inch double-spoke 668 M Cerium Grey wheels. The interior is equipped with BMW Individual Piano Black interior, Alcantara headliner, and premium Merino leather seats.


The New M550i xDrive British Racing Green is powered by an M TwinPower Turbo V8 gasoline engine producing 530 horsepower and 76.5 kg·m of torque, paired with an 8-speed Steptronic Sport automatic transmission, achieving a 0-100 km/h acceleration time of 3.8 seconds. Additionally, it comes standard with BMW Laser Lights, Bowers & Wilkins audio system, and BMW Digital Key. The price is 121.8 million KRW.

The M340i Dravit Grey is limited to 30 units. 'Dravit Grey' is a unique color first introduced in the 'M340i xDrive Touring BMW Korea 25th Anniversary Dravit Grey Edition,' which sold out within 15 minutes of its launch last September.


The front of the body features a black high-gloss front splitter, while the rear is equipped with a carbon fiber rear spoiler and diffuser. The interior includes a dashboard finished with premium natural leather, M sport seats inspired by racing bucket seats, and M seat belts. The M340i Dravit Grey is powered by an M TwinPower Turbo inline 6-cylinder gasoline engine producing 387 horsepower and 51.0 kg·m of torque, with a 0-100 km/h acceleration time of 4.6 seconds.



Furthermore, it offers BMW's signature Laser Lights, Harman Kardon sound system, ambient lighting, as well as the latest driver assistance features such as Parking Assistant Plus and Driving Assistant Professional. The price of the M340i Dravit Grey is 80.7 million KRW including VAT.
